The global Zebrafish Market encompasses the sale and utilization of Danio rerio models, associated specialized equipment, consumables, and services tailored for biomedical research, pharmaceutical screening, and developmental biology studies. Zebrafish have emerged as pivotal vertebrate models due to their small size, high reproductive rate, rapid external development, genetic tractability, and significant physiological homology (approximately 70% of human genes have counterparts in zebrafish). This intrinsic biological suitability makes them ideal for large-scale genetic screens and high-throughput drug toxicity and efficacy testing, providing a crucial intermediate step between invertebrate models and mammalian systems like mice, thereby accelerating the pre-clinical validation process.
Key products within this market include wild-type zebrafish lines, genetically modified strains (transgenic and knockout models), specialized housing systems (aquatic rack systems, filtration units, and monitoring technology), and analytical software for image processing and behavioral phenotyping. Major applications span oncology research, cardiovascular disease modeling, neurobiology, and regenerative medicine, leveraging the fish's transparent embryos for real-time visualization of cellular and developmental processes. The primary benefits driving market adoption include cost-effectiveness compared to traditional rodent models, the ability to screen thousands of compounds rapidly, and enhanced ethical considerations surrounding reduced severity protocols.

AI's primary influence is centralized around automation and enhanced data interpretation, fundamentally altering how experiments are designed, executed, and analyzed within high-throughput screening facilities. Machine learning algorithms are now routinely applied to complex imaging data generated from transparent zebrafish embryos, allowing for the rapid detection and classification of subtle developmental abnormalities (teratogenicity) or disease progression markers that are invisible or impractical to quantify manually. This capability dramatically increases the throughput of toxicology studies and accelerates the identification of promising drug candidates, minimizing false positives and resource wastage early in the pre-clinical pipeline.
Furthermore, AI algorithms are crucial in developing sophisticated behavioral tracking systems, which analyze swimming parameters, social interactions, and responses to stimuli in adult and larval zebrafish models used for neurobiology and psychological disorder research. Deep learning models provide robust predictive capabilities, allowing researchers to simulate the effect of novel compounds on specific biological pathways within the zebrafish, thereby optimizing experimental parameters before wet-lab validation. This integration of computational power not only streamlines the research process but also elevates the scientific rigor and reproducibility of zebrafish-based studies, paving the way for wider acceptance of this model in regulatory submissions.

The technological landscape of the Zebrafish Market is characterized by sophisticated automation, advanced genetic manipulation tools, and high-resolution imaging capabilities designed to maximize experimental throughput and precision. Genetic engineering techniques, particularly the widespread adoption of CRISPR-Cas9, represent the foundational technology, allowing researchers to rapidly generate precise knock-in, knock-out, and conditional mutant lines that faithfully model human diseases. This technological leap has significantly reduced the time required for model creation, moving the focus from model generation to high-volume phenotypic analysis. The integration of site-specific mutagenesis ensures that models are highly relevant and reproducible across different research settings, which is critical for standardization.
Automated housing and maintenance systems form another crucial technological pillar. Modern aquatic systems feature advanced water quality monitoring, automated filtration (biological and mechanical), integrated disinfection protocols (UV sterilization), and sophisticated environmental controls to maintain optimal parameters (temperature, pH, conductivity). Companies supplying this technology are focused on creating modular, scalable rack systems that minimize labor requirements and ensure the health and welfare of large colonies, thereby reducing operational variance and improving experimental outcomes. These systems often incorporate digital monitoring dashboards accessible remotely, ensuring continuous operational oversight and immediate alert capabilities for critical parameters.
In the downstream research phase, key technologies include high-content screening (HCS) systems and specialized microscopy for live imaging. HCS platforms integrate automated liquid handling with high-speed, confocal, or light-sheet microscopy to capture complex phenotypic data from thousands of embryos simultaneously. Furthermore, behavioral analysis technology utilizes high-speed cameras and sophisticated AI-driven software packages (e.g., EthoVision) to track, quantify, and analyze subtle behavioral changes in larval and adult fish, providing crucial data for neurobiological and toxicology studies. The convergence of these imaging, automation, and AI technologies is defining the state-of-the-art in zebrafish research, enabling faster translation of findings from the laboratory bench to therapeutic development.
